Designing a product and getting it to functionally work is only part of the process of bringing a new product to market.

The other, and more increasingly onerous requirement, is the verification and validation requirements to prove that the product performs against any manufacturer claims as that it complies with the relevant regulatory legislation.

Using a wearable smart watch as a case study, this presentation will highlight what a manufacturer needs to think about at the start of a new product design to ensure that all the validation assessments are captured and planned throughout the product development.

Using Element’s experience, the presentation will recommend at what point derisk assessments can be performed to provide a higher degree of certainty on compliance as the product nears market readiness.

Attendees will learn:
• Why considering verification and validation at the start of a product is important
• What regulation and industry certification is needed
• How to plan this into a product development cycle
• Why performing derisk testing during a product development saves money
• Why choosing a partner wisely for verification and validation is important

Steve Hayes
Technical Director ‑ Connected Technologies
Steve is Chartered Engineer and technical director for Element’s Connected Technology business unit. He has been involved with helping manufacturers comply with worldwide legislation for over 30 years and held positions of test engineer, to lab manager and business unit leader.
Steve is involved with helping to define product validation requirements within the standards world and chairs a number of committees and forums on EMC, RF and product regulations.
